#16 ·
Welcome to the org! And to answer your question yes and no haha... When we talk about the x3 and cd/cts combo we are talking about using the x3 to tune the truck with custom tunes from the guys and gals that write the files we run.. And we use the cs/cts to monitor everything.. I am not even familure with with whether or not you can use the cs or cts with the juice platinum/attitude that edge has had for awhile?? But you don't want edge tuning because it's "generic" for lack of a better term and the sct is custom to your trucks strategy and tunes your tranny which the edge will not... So yes the sct is that good and the edge tuning is that bad... the differnce between the evolution and the insight is that the evolution programs (tunes) the truck and provides monitoring while the insight is just for monitoring..
